My Buying Guides on ‘Face Wash Tree Tea’

When I first started looking for a good face wash with tea tree, I realized there are quite a few things to consider to get the best product for my skin. Here’s what I learned along the way, and what I keep in mind whenever I shop for a face wash containing tea tree oil.

Why I Choose Tea Tree Face Wash

Tea tree oil is known for its natural antibacterial and anti-inflammatory properties. For me, it helps keep breakouts under control and soothes redness. If you have acne-prone or oily skin like I do, a face wash with tea tree can be a great addition to your routine.

Checking the Ingredients

I always look beyond just “tea tree” on the label. A good tea tree face wash should have a decent concentration of tea tree oil but also other gentle, skin-friendly ingredients. Avoid harsh sulfates or artificial fragrances that can irritate sensitive skin. Natural moisturizers like aloe vera or glycerin are a plus.

Skin Type Compatibility

My skin is combination and tends to get oily around the T-zone but dry on the cheeks. I found that some tea tree face washes can be drying if they’re too strong. If your skin is sensitive or dry, look for a formula labeled as gentle or hydrating. For oily or acne-prone skin, a foaming or gel-based wash works well.

Packaging and Quantity

I prefer pumps or squeeze tubes for hygienic and easy use. Also, consider how much product you get for the price. Sometimes a bigger bottle means better value, but I like to try smaller sizes first to see how my skin reacts.

Price vs. Quality

There are affordable and high-end tea tree face washes out there. I’ve noticed that price doesn’t always guarantee better results. Look for trusted brands with good reviews and ingredients you recognize. Sometimes mid-range options strike the best balance.

Personal Testing and Patch Test

Before fully committing, I always do a patch test to check for any allergic reactions. Tea tree oil can be potent, so it’s important to see how your skin handles it. Start using the face wash gradually and monitor how your skin responds over a week or two.

Additional Benefits I Look For

Some tea tree face washes include extra benefits like exfoliation with natural beads, added antioxidants, or calming botanicals. Depending on my skin’s needs, I sometimes pick these for a more comprehensive skincare routine.
